How they compare
Hungary currently reports 15.6% against 13.2% in Denmark, a difference of 2.4%.
That makes Hungary's figure about 1.2 times Denmark's.
Across all 17 years both countries report, Hungary has been ahead every year.
Denmark ranks 41st and Hungary ranks 37th of 47 countries.
Hungary has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Denmark | Hungary |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 6.7% | 31.0% | 24.3% | Hungary |
| 2010s | 8.9% | 33.3% | 24.4% | Hungary |
| 2020s | 10.9% | 12.9% | 2.1% | Hungary |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
